I'd like to celebrate with this wonderful little cluster of mushrooms I found on the Coal Creek walkway near Runanga.
They are Humidicutis mavis, a white spored mushroom that is found in leaf litter during the Autumn here.
They are often found singly, so I considered myself very lucky to have found such a neat wee clump.
